Key points from the World Congress in Monaco

Skin quality treatments

John says:

“There has been a growing emphasis over recent years on the importance of skin complexion and quality – smooth and even skin tone is universally seen as desirable across all cultures and arguably makes more impact than lines and wrinkles. There are now plenty of effective options for delivering this, whether via high-quality skincare, injectables or devices such as laser, IPL or ultrasound.. All can be effective and of course our aim is to advise on the best option for a particular individual.

“A particularly interesting treatment that we have been using in a small way up to now is Gouri – a collagen-stimulating liquid injectable.

“It offers improvement after just one treatment, and in addition has shown promising improvement in skin problems such as rosacea and melasma.”

Neck treatments

Traditionally, societal beauty standards and marketing for anti-aging products have placed a heavy emphasis on the face. This can lead patients and providers alike to prioritise facial rejuvenation over the neck. However, the skin on the neck is thinner and less elastic than facial skin. This makes it more prone to wrinkles, creasing, and sagging, but also more sensitive to harsh products or procedures. Improving the appearance of the neck is a real opportunity.

Dr John Tanqueray says:

“Treatments for improving laxity or crepiness in the neck have been emerging over recent years, and there are now some well-established treatments and techniques that can make a real difference in the appropriate patient.

“Again the newer product Gouri has shown promise in this area too.”

Psychological factors

Dr John Tanqueray welcomed the increased recognition of psychological factors in aesthetic treatments and the concerns around protecting the patients best interests. He commented:

“It was pleasing to see more focus than ever before on psychological factors that can lead to over-treatment, and safety.”
